Software Developer Resume
Shakopee, Mn
SUMMARY:
- 5+ years experience in software Development containing desktop/mobile web, desktop application, database, and reports development and testing.
- 2+ years experience in automated testing to improve software quality, and managing and performing manual.
- Working knowledge of application coding methodologies, source code version management (GIT, Subversion, WinCVS), Pattern best practices, and the SDLC model, specifically Agile and Iterative approaches.
TECHNICAL SKILLS:
Languages: Java, PHP, Spring (Security, MVC), Hibernate, JPA, Jersey
Web: Web 2.0, Web API, Restful Web Services, HTML(5), CSS(3), DOM, XML, XSL, JavaScript, ECMAScript5, jQuery/jQuery UI, Angular, AJAX, JSON, JSP, Servlet
Databases: MySQL, MS Access, Vantage Progress DB, Google Cloud
Tools: Eclipse, Selenium IDE, Spring Tool Suite
Platforms: Ubuntu, Linux, Windows XP
SDLC Methodologies: Agile, SCRUM
PROFESSIONAL EXPERIENCE:
Confidential, Shakopee MN
Software Developer
Responsibilities:
- Analyzed, planed, designed, and implemented project
- Designed Web UI by using Twitter - bootstrap, CSS(3), HTML(5)
- Developed Restful calls with web API that return JSON results for data binding and to implement other business logic.
- Developed the client test tool for REST service endpoints and validate results.
- Fixed bugs, changed requests, added new features, fixed feedback from clients
- Built and Deployed Web Application
Technical Environment: Spring Tool Suite (STS), Java, Jersey, Hibernate, JPA, Javascript, Angular, ECMAScript5, DOM, HTML(5), CSS(3), Twitter Bootstrap, Maven, Apache Tomcat
Confidential, Lakeville MN
Software Developer
Responsibilities:
- Analyzed and tracked the issues
- Fix issue on Registration Page
- Fix issue on Administration Monthly Common Page
- Performed unit test and participated in all phases of testing including integration test, system test and field test
Technical Environment: Spring Tool Suite, Core & OOP PHP, Java, JSP, Struts 2, jQuery, Javascript, XHTML, CSS
Confidential, Shakopee MN
Software Developer & Test
Responsibilities:
- Analyzed, planed, and designed projects
- Design Web UI by using Wireframe, Twitter-bootstrap, UX/UI
- Developed Restful calls with web API that return JSON results for data binding and to implement other business logic
- Developed the client test tool for REST service endpoints and validate results
- Worked on test plan, test cases, and automated several high priority test cases including UI tests
- Fixed bugs, change requests, add new features, fixed feedback from clients
- Build and Deploy (Snapshot or Release version) to three different server such as Test, Stage, and Production Server
Technical Environment: Spring Tool Suite, Google Cloud, jQuery/jQuery UI, Angular, Object-Oriented Javascript, ECMAScript5, DOM, HTML(5), CSS(3), Twitter Bootstrap, Web Service (Restful API), AJAX, JSON, Google App Engine (GAE), Apache, Jenkins, GIT, Gerrit, JIRA, Agile
Confidential
Software Developer & Test
Responsibilities:
- Extraction data or generating report:
- Generating Reports as text file output, Excel file output, XML file output, PDF file output, and HTML file output
- Configure Web Application Server depending on the version of FARM
- Testing reports by COM REPORT, and COM BULK REPORT
- Build Client Structure: package the project depending on client
- Working on Batch Java, and configure web application server:
- Checkout projects, build class path, and deploy project
- Build application in order retrieve data from data store (Database) to generate output files (text file, XML file)
- Build application to insert data or store data to database from input files (text file, XML file, etc.)
- Training new comers:
- FIMASYS’s business and ALLWEB structure
- Check out project, build class path, deploy project
- Configure Maven 1, Maven 2, COM REPORT, COM BULK REPORT, JBOSS, and WEBLOGIC
- Guide some basic with PL/SQL, and Batch Java
- Create report in FARM
Technologies used: Java, Oracle, SQL, PLSQL, Toad, XML, HTML, Javascript, XHTML, CSS, Win CVS, Eclipse, Bugzillar, Maven, JBOSS, WEBLOGIC, Hand Coding